Y73.2
ICD-10-CMProsthetic and other implants, materials and accessory gastroenterology and urology devices associated with adverse incidents
This code signifies an adverse event or complication arising from a prosthetic or other implantable device specifically used in the gastrointestinal or urological systems. This includes issues like device malfunction, displacement, infection, or rejection related to these specific types of implants.
Assign this code when a patient experiences a complication directly attributable to a gastroenterology or urology implant, such as a urinary catheter, stent, colostomy device, or gastric band. This would be used in conjunction with a code describing the specific nature of the adverse event (e.g., infection, mechanical complication).
